> > Why 64 for the global limit but only 1 for the cgroup limit? That
> > seems arbitrary in multiple ways.
>
> I suggested that we keep the writeback here without batching and do
> that change separately, mainly out of abundance of caution as
> writeback is done synchronously here so the extra latency could be
> problematic. I think we probably want to measure the performance
> impact of that separately.
>
> That being said, this path is potentially too expensive anyway due to
> the flush, but I would rather we do some basic measurements before
> batching here.
>
> What do you think?

It's not an unknown, right? We know this works for direct reclaimers,
cgroup limit reclaim e.g., and what the latency implications are.

Because of how reclaim works, we also know it'll call zswap_store() in
batches of SWAP_CLUSTER_MAX. If we don't batch here, they're likely to
each call shrink_memcg() once we're at the limit - while still risking
rejections due to compressibility differences.

My worry is that if we start with an inconsistency, we'll be stuck
with it for a long time.

I'd rather start with the clean, consistent version. Dial it back only
if we have data to justfiy the complication that we can put into a
comment and the changelog that outlines why exactly it's different.
